BIRD v. PENN CENTRAL COMPANY

Civ. A. No. 71-358.

341 F.Supp. 291 (1972)

John Basil BIRD et al., Plaintiffs, v. The PENN CENTRAL COMPANY et al., Defendants.

United States District Court, E. D. Pennsylvania.

April 21, 1972.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

James J. Binns, Philadelphia, Pa., E. Barrett Prettyman, Jr., Stuart Philip Ross, Washington, D. C., Robert G. Schloerb, Chicago, Ill., for plaintiffs.

Henry T. Reath, Philadelphia, Pa., for defendants Ferdinand L. Kattau and William F. Kirk.

David P. Bruton, Lewis H. Van Dusen, Jr., Philadelphia, Pa., for defendant Walter H. Annenberg.


OPINION

JOSEPH S. LORD, III, Chief Judge.

This is a diversity case governed by Pennsylvania law. Plaintiffs in this action are certain named underwriters trading under the name of Lloyds of London. On July 2, 1968 they issued what we construe as two separate policies1 providing coverage for the defendants.
